Alexandra Deignan Joins Lazard as Head of Investor Relations

Lazard Ltd (NYSE:LAZ) announced today that Alexandra Deignan has joined the firm as Head of Investor Relations, effective immediately. Based in New York, Ms. Deignan will oversee the firm’s investor relations activities with Evan Russo, Chief Financial Officer.

Ms. Deignan has more than 20 years of experience in investor relations and investment banking. Prior to joining Lazard, Ms. Deignan served as Vice President, Investor Relations for Schnitzer Steel Industries from 2010 to 2017. She served as Director of Investor Relations for Curtiss-Wright from 2003 to 2010. Previously, she worked in the investment banking division of Salomon Smith Barney, from 1998 to 2002. She began her career at Daniel J. Edelman in 1993.

Ms. Deignan received a Bachelor of Journalism from University of Texas at Austin and a Master of Business Administration from New York University. She has served as a Board member of the National Investor Relations Institute’s New York chapter since 2016.

About Lazard

Lazard, one of the world’s preeminent financial advisory and asset management firms, operates from 43 cities across 27 countries in North America, Europe, Asia, Australia, Central and South America. With origins dating to 1848, the firm provides advice on mergers and acquisitions, strategic matters, restructuring and capital structure, capital raising and corporate finance, as well as asset management services to corporations, partnerships, institutions, governments and individuals.
